Analysis

Togo recorded 0.0% for capital expenditure as a percentage of total expenditure in in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 12 years on record.

That represents a change of down 100.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, capital expenditure as a percentage of total expenditure in in Togo peaked at 24.5% in 1998 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 2024.

Togo ranks 106th of 108 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Capital expenditure as a percentage of total expenditure in in Togo, year by year

Annual values for Capital expenditure as a percentage of total expenditure in upper-secondary public institutions (%) in Togo, 1998 to 2024.
Year % Change
1998 24.5%
1999 1.4% -94.3%
2000 7.4% +432.5%
2009 1.3% -82.8%
2010 8.2% +545.6%
2011 1.8% -78.5%
2012 1.2% -32.3%
2013 2.5% +108.3%
2014 1.4% -45.1%
2015 5.6% +309.6%
2016 3.6% -36.2%
2024 0.0% -100.0%
